Search our geolocation database.
Enter your Search Pattern
You've searched for
"3 willow end "28630668, 3 Willow End, Queen Street, Eye, Ip21 5hh, Suffolk,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
52472287, 3 Willow End, London Road, Tetbury, Gl8 8hr, Gloucestershire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
